High Gain Tube Amps
Selecting from the best high gain tube amps involves considering a few key factors: wattage, portability, onboard features, and the specific tonal character you’re after. Lower-wattage models are ideal for home studios or small venues, offering all the tube-driven saturation at manageable volumes. Larger amps, with their robust transformers and multiple channels, are perfect for players who need versatility and headroom for bigger stages. Many high gain amps include built-in effects loops, multiple voicing options, and even direct recording outputs, making them as at home in the studio as they are on stage. These features are invaluable for gigging musicians who need to tailor their sound on the fly or integrate with complex pedalboards.
